Description

An exciting opportunity to acquire a 25% share of this part-buy/part-rent 3 bedroom end terrace family residence. The property offers spacious and comfortable accommodation throughout and benefits from a level rear enclosed garden and off road parking. EPC B & Council Tax Band B. Available with no onward chain.

The property occupies a quiet location within the village which supports a post office/stores, primary school and places of worship. Whitstone itself lies close to the Devon/Cornwall border surrounded by unspoilt countryside and conveniently situated for the neighbouring towns of Holsworthy, Bude and Launceston all some 9/10 miles distant. Holsworthy is popular for its weekly market and range of traditional market town amenities including popular golf course, bowling green, swimming pool etc. Bude is renowned for its safe sandy surfing beaches and breathtaking coastline, whilst Launceston Cornwall's ancient capital has the benefit of the A30 dual carriageway providing a speedy link to the M5 motorway network and beyond.

Agent Note

We are offering a 25% share through sanctuary housing, part buy part rent with a remaining lease term of 85 years. Sanctuary Housing are the housing association, interested parties will need to go through an application process, and should register with the help to buy agency. The guidelines for interested parties are as below. 1.The buyer is in need of accommodation. 2.The buyers income is sufficient to purchase the property and is adequate to meet its future outgoings. 3.The buyer must require the size of property being purchased. 4.The buyer must not own another property. Any applicant for the property is would need to provide evidence to Sanctuary Housing that they have a local connection to the relevant parishes which includes, Whitstone, Boyton, Marhamchurch, Week St. Mary, North Tamerton, Bridgerule or Pyworthy.
